Lava dome formation occurs when magma too viscous to flow far, typically silica-rich dacite or rhyolite, is extruded at a vent and piles up over and around it rather than spreading into a lava flow, building a steep-sided mound directly above the conduit. A growing dome is unstable and prone to collapse, which can trigger fast-moving pyroclastic flows and block-and-ash flows down the volcano flank, the mechanism behind some of the deadliest eruptions in recorded history, including Mont Pelee in 1902.
